## 7.0.0 — Profile Store Sharding

Breaking: Fernvault user-profile store is now sharded by account hash. Single-node mode removed. Defaults changed: write quorum raised, read-repair enabled, rebalance window narrowed to off-peak. Migrations run automatically on first boot; expect one-time latency spike. Old connection strings are rejected — update all clients before deploying. Rollback below 7.0.0 is unsupported once rebalance completes. New default configuration values ship as follows.

deployment values, kajep-kageg:
[praix]
host = praix.paliqcorp.corp
user = praix_svc
database = praix_prod

Runbook fragment — exhibition loans, outbound. Three pieces from the Ferndale Gallery loan return Monday: crated, foam-lined, tamper tape on every seam. Office manager verifies crate numbers against the loan schedule and signs the condition report before release. No crate leaves without both signatures. Climate-controlled van only. On arrival, the courier receives the hand-over instruction noted below.

courier memo of tawep-tajep: the quenius ulaiel courier leaves the fenir ledger at gate 9128 under passcode 527513

Subject: Quickstore 4.2 — bloom filter now fronts the KV layer

Plugin authors: starting with this release, Quickstore places a bloom filter ahead of the key-value store. Negative lookups return faster; false positives fall through safely. No API changes are required on your side. Verify your plugin against the staging build referenced below.

session token of fahif-tadup = htk3_9c7